本頁面中的部分或全部資訊可能不適用於 Trusted Cloud by S3NS。
貢獻分析總覽
您可以使用貢獻分析 (又稱為主要動力分析),產生有關多維資料中主要指標變化的洞察資料。舉例來說,您可以使用貢獻分析來查看兩個季度的收益數字變化,或是比較兩組訓練資料,瞭解機器學習模型成效的變化。您可以使用 CREATE MODEL
陳述式在 BigQuery 中建立貢獻分析模型。
貢獻分析是一種擴增分析,也就是運用人工智慧 (AI) 來強化及自動化分析資料和瞭解資料。貢獻分析可達成擴增分析的主要目標之一,也就是協助使用者在資料中找出模式。
貢獻度分析模型會比較測試資料集和控制資料集,找出顯示指標變化的資料區段。舉例來說,您可以使用 2023 年底的銷售資料表快照做為測試資料,以及 2022 年底的資料表快照做為控制資料,瞭解銷售量隨時間變化的情形。貢獻分析模型可顯示哪個資料區隔 (例如特定區域的線上顧客),對一年內銷售額的變化影響最大。
指標是貢獻分析模型用來評估及比較測試資料和控制資料之間變化的數值。您可以使用貢獻度分析模型,指定可相加指標、可相加的比率指標或可依類別相加指標。
區隔是指由維度值的特定組合所識別的資料切片。舉例來說,如果貢獻分析模式是根據 store_number
、customer_id
和 day
維度建立,則這些維度值的每個不重複組合都代表一個區隔。在下表中,每列代表不同的區隔:
store_number |
customer_id |
day |
商店 1 |
|
|
商店 1 |
客戶 1 |
|
商店 1 |
客戶 1 |
星期一 |
商店 1 |
客戶 1 |
星期二 |
商店 1 |
客戶 2 |
|
商店 2 |
|
|
如要縮短模型建立時間,並只建立最大且最相關的區隔,請指定先驗支援門檻,藉此裁減模型使用的小區隔。
建立貢獻度分析模型後,您可以使用 ML.GET_INSIGHTS
函式擷取模型計算的指標資訊。模型輸出內容包含多列洞察資料,每個洞察資料都會提供一個區隔和相應的指標。
後續步驟
除非另有註明,否則本頁面中的內容是採用創用 CC 姓名標示 4.0 授權,程式碼範例則為阿帕契 2.0 授權。詳情請參閱《Google Developers 網站政策》。Java 是 Oracle 和/或其關聯企業的註冊商標。
上次更新時間:2025-08-08 (世界標準時間)。
[[["容易理解","easyToUnderstand","thumb-up"],["確實解決了我的問題","solvedMyProblem","thumb-up"],["其他","otherUp","thumb-up"]],[["缺少我需要的資訊","missingTheInformationINeed","thumb-down"],["過於複雜/步驟過多","tooComplicatedTooManySteps","thumb-down"],["過時","outOfDate","thumb-down"],["翻譯問題","translationIssue","thumb-down"],["示例/程式碼問題","samplesCodeIssue","thumb-down"],["其他","otherDown","thumb-down"]],["上次更新時間:2025-08-08 (世界標準時間)。"],[[["Contribution analysis, also known as key driver analysis, helps identify changes in key metrics across multi-dimensional data."],["This feature, currently in a pre-GA stage, is available \"as is\" with potential limited support, and subject to the \"Pre-GA Offerings Terms\"."],["Contribution analysis models compare a test data set to a control data set to identify statistically significant changes across various dimensions, such as time or location."],["A `CREATE MODEL` statement in BigQuery can be used to build a contribution analysis model, and these models can use either summable or summable ratio metrics."],["The `ML.GET_INSIGHTS` function allows users to retrieve metric information calculated by a created contribution analysis model."]]],[]]